Ingredients

List of Ingredients

– 1 cup cold brewed coffee

– 1/2 cup milk (or your favorite dairy alternative)

– 2 tablespoons pumpkin puree

– 1 tablespoon maple syrup (adjust to taste)

– 1/2 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ice (plus extra for garnish)

– 1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ract

– Ice cubes

– Whipped cream (optional, for topping)

Recommended Equipment

– Tall glass

– Mixing bowl or measuring cup

– Whisk or milk frother

– Spoon

Ingredient Substitutions

You can swap the milk for almond, oat, or coconut milk. Use honey instead of maple syrup for sweetness. If you want fewer spices, you can skip the pumpkin pie spice. Just use pumpkin puree for a rich flavor. Use espresso for a stronger coffee taste if you prefer. This drink is flexible, so feel free to experiment! For a fun twist, try flavored syrups or add a scoop of vanilla ice cream instead of whipped cream. Enjoy this seasonal delight your way!

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preparation of Cold Brew Coffee

To make the cold brew coffee, start by brewing it in advance. You can use a store-bought version if you’re short on time. Fill a tall glass halfway with ice cubes. Pour the cold coffee over the ice until the glass is about three-quarters full. This creates a nice base for your float.

Making the Pumpkin Spice Cold Foam

Next, let’s craft the pumpkin spice cold foam. In a small bowl or measuring cup, mix together the milk, pumpkin puree, maple syrup, pumpkin pie spice, and vanilla extract. Whisk the mixture until it’s well combined. If you want it frothier, use a milk frother or blender. This will add air and make it light and fluffy.

Assembling the Pumpkin Spice Cold Foam Float

Now, it’s time to assemble your float. Gently pour the fluffy pumpkin spice cold foam over the cold coffee. Aim for a layered look. If needed, use the back of a spoon to help create a clean separation between the coffee and the foam. For extra flair, you can add whipped cream on top and sprinkle some pumpkin pie spice for garnish. Enjoy your Pumpkin Spice Cold Foam Float!

Tips & Tricks

Achieving the Perfect Foam Texture

To make great foam, start with cold ingredients. Cold milk creates a better froth. Use a milk frother or blender to whip the mix. Whisk it fast until it feels light and fluffy. If you want a thicker foam, add more pumpkin puree. This gives it body.

Adjusting Sweetness to Taste

Sweetness can change the drink’s vibe. Start with one tablespoon of maple syrup. Then taste and adjust as needed. If you prefer less sweet, use just half a tablespoon. For a sweeter drink, add more syrup or try honey. Your taste matters most!

Using Quality Ingredients for Best Flavor

Using quality ingredients boosts your drink’s taste. Choose fresh pumpkin puree for a rich flavor. Use whole milk for creaminess, or pick your favorite dairy alternative. High-quality maple syrup adds depth. Always use fresh spices for the best aroma and taste, too.

Storage Info

How to Store Leftover Cold Foam

If you have leftover cold foam, store it in an airtight container. Place it in the fridge. Use it within one day for the best taste. This foam can lose its fluffiness over time, so make sure to enjoy it soon.

Best Practices for Cold Brew Coffee

Store your cold brew coffee in a sealed jar or pitcher. Keep it in the fridge. It stays fresh for about a week. If you want to enjoy the best flavor, consume it within three to five days.

Shelf Life of Ingredients

The pumpkin puree lasts about a week in the fridge once opened. Maple syrup can stay good for a long time if kept in a cool, dark place. Check the expiration date on your milk or dairy alternative. Use it before it spoils for the best taste in your Pumpkin Spice Cold Foam Floats.
